Katie Goh joins Gutter


The Gutter team is delighted to welcome Katie Goh, who has taken on the role of Prose Reviews Editor. Katie has a wealth of writing and editing experience that she’ll bring to the magazine. She is Non-Fiction Editor at Extra Teeth and was First Person Editor at gal-dem. She’s written for many publications, including VICE, i-D and the Guardian, and her book Foreign Fruit will be published by Canongate in 2025.

Together with our Poetry Reviews Editor Sean Wai Keung, Katie will oversee some changes to Gutter’s reviews section in the coming months, including a regular online review series that will be launched in June.

‘Katie is a tremendous talent,’ said Gutter’s Managing Editor Malachy Tallack. ‘She brings a great deal of knowledge about new Scottish writing together with energy and enthusiasm for this role. As Gutter continues to grow and develop, we’re very lucky to have her on board.’
